She may be a talented actress, singer, and dancer, but when it comes to chaffing it up in the kitchen, Zendaya may be lacking some skill. And she is well aware of that, especially after a kitchen accident led the Hollywood star to the hospital to get stitches! Here's what went down.

The Euphoria actress shared the ordeal with her Instagram followers by posting a picture of a bloody finger that was wrapped in gauze and a bandage. "See now...this is why I don't cook," she teased. Of course, this sled to fans wondering what could have happened? Luckily she kept them updated. And shortly after she shared another snap of a doctor stitching up her finger, "Update" she wrote on the story. While we still don't know what exactly Zendaya was trying to make when the accident happen, we do know that she probably won't be attempting that recipe again anytime soon. "Baby's first stitches LOL back to never cooking again," she added next to a third photo alongside her assistant Darnell Appling.

Appling also shared his side of the funny story on his Instagram "Never a dull moment with @zendaya no pun intended," he hilariously wrote. "Dear God, help me keep this little heffa safe cause she clumsy as h*ll." Apparently, this was not the first-time Zendaya had an incident in the kitchen. Last December, her 25-year-old boyfriend, Tom Holland revealed, "Zendaya, every time she cooks, she comes millimeters from not chopping her fingers off, or her hand off." Last week Zendaya was nominated for not one, not two, but three Emmys for her work on HBO hit series Euphoria. She is up for the award of Outstanding Lead Actress and she also got two nods for Outstanding Original Music And Lyrics for her help in writing both "Elliot's Song" and I'm Tired. Just two years ago the actress received he first Emmy for her performance as Rue Bennett in the drama series. This achievement made her the youngest star to win the best actress in a drama series.
